5 All requests for public or commercial use and translation Rights shouldbe submitted to Requests for permission to photocopy portions of this material for public or commercial use shall beaddressed directly to the Copyright Clearance Center (CCC) at or the Centre fran ais d exploitation du droit de copie (CFC)at cite this publication as:OECD (2012), Related Party Transactions and Minority Shareholder Rights , OECD Party Transactions AND Minority Shareholder Rights OECD 20123 ForewordThis report presents the results of the third thematic peer review based on the OECD Principles ofCorporate Governance.

6 The report is focused on the corporate governance framework thatmanages Related Party Transactions with the aim to protect Minority investors. It covers over30 jurisdictions, including in-depth reviews of Belgium, France, India, Israel,* Italy and report is based in part on a questionnaire that was sent to all participating jurisdictions inMay 2011. All jurisdictions were invited to respond to a general set of questions so as to provide anoverall context within which the review would take place. The five jurisdictions that were subject tothe in-depth review were invited to respond to a more extensive set of questions and there was alsoa visit by the OECD to consult a wider range of market report first reviews the experience of the five jurisdictions in managing Related partytransactions which is set against a general review of legislation in over 30 jurisdictions.

7 The second partcomprises the in-depth review of the five jurisdictions. The report was prepared by Grant Kirkpatrick andDaniel Blume with inputs by Akira Nozaki and approved for publication under the authority of the OECDC orporate Governance Committee in December OECD corporate governance peer review process is designed to facilitate effectiveimplementation of the principles and to assist market participants and policy makers to respond toemerging corporate governance risks. The reviews are also forward looking so as to help indentify, atan early stage, key market practices and policy developments that may undermine the quality ofcorporate governance.
